Output f66b593d8c442813ea3da53f1ae6e08f68f3700a87b91d8dcfe7136ebf4e374d:1

value
402986
script pubkey
OP_0 OP_PUSHBYTES_20 2f4a5c95e5433bde9f696edd1d3a0049af73cc82
address
bc1q9a99e909gvaaa8mfdmw36wsqfxhh8nyz4x8gnh
transaction
f66b593d8c442813ea3da53f1ae6e08f68f3700a87b91d8dcfe7136ebf4e374d